Master Transponder Key Transmitter for Toyota
This OEM‑grade master transponder key module is the heart of the immobilizer handshake. It stores the encrypted ID that your Toyota’s ECU accepts to authorize ignition. With a valid master profile, you can start the engine and also add new keys when needed. It is the correct fit for owners who lost the master or are replacing a worn, unreadable chip.
Why you need it
It ensures anti‑theft security, clean starts, and proper pairing with the immobilizer. Without a working master, programming extra keys becomes difficult or impossible.
How it works
Inside is a passive RFID chip. When you insert the key, the antenna coil around the ignition sends a low‑frequency signal. The chip replies with a coded ID. The ECU compares this ID; if matched, fuel and spark are enabled. No battery needed for the chip itself.
If it fails ❗
- Engine cranks but will not start or starts then stalls
- Security light flashes; “key not recognized” behavior
- Intermittent starting; cannot register new keys
Install & programming tips ⚙️
Cut the blade to code, then program via Techstream or a qualified locksmith using immobilizer procedures. Keep at least one working key on hand, avoid strong magnets, and store the chip away from moisture.
